The Polish authorities deliberately provided the Ukrainian military with the sky for drone strikes on Russia. This was stated by the deputy of the Polish Sejm Wlodzimierz Skalik.
"Deliberate provocation — by acting in this way, our authorities want the Russian Federation to recognize the territory of Poland as a legitimate target of its retaliatory military actions," he said.
In his opinion, the ban on flights along the borders with Ukraine and Belarus introduced on March 10 actually allows the Ukrainian army to attack oil facilities in the Leningrad region and the ports of Ust-Luga and Primorsk. Skalik believes that these actions are an attempt to draw Poland into a war with the Russian Federation. Therefore, he called for "saying no to warmongers."
Recall that in recent weeks, Ukraine has been actively attacking the northwestern regions of Russia with drones. Some of the drones fell on the territory of the Baltic states and Finland.
